An ncRNA may have the following functions: scaffold, guide, alterer of protein function or stability, ribozyme, blocker, and/or decoy. Which of those functions is/are mediated by each of the ncRNAs listed next? (Note: A single ncRNA may have more than one function.)
A. HOTAIR
B. RNA of RNaseP
C. microRNA
D. crRNA

The RNAi and the microRNA (miRNA) pathways share many components and characteristics. What unique feature distinguishes the microRNA pathway from RNAi?
a) only the RNAi pathway is initiated by dsRNA molecules
b) the miRNA pathway does not require Dicer
c) the miRNA pathway does not require RISC.
d) miRNAs have 100% complementarity with their mRNA targets to block translation
e) siRNAs that act in RNAi have 100% complementarity with their mRNA targets resulting in endonucleolytic cleavage
